The Mystery Of Edwin Drood
   
  Tickets are now on sale for Lake Catholic's Spring Musical. Based on an unfinished Charles Dickens novel, the audience plays its part by helping to solve the Mystery of Edwin Drood.
   
  Drood is a rousing, hilarious, heart-wrenching show with wonderful music, lyrics and lines by Rupert Holmes. Led by the Chairman, the cast play actors who take us through the story by assuming characters in the plot. The problem they face, however, is due to Mr Dickens’ rather untimely demise, leaving them without an ending and no resolution to the mystery they have presented. Thankfully, and despite Queen Victoria, British democracy prevails and the audience is given the opportunity to choose how to end the show. Incidentally, there are six endings and six shows, so if you want to see all the possibilities…
